An attic sometimes referred to as a loft is a space found directly below the pitched roof of a house or other building.
An attic is a room at the top of a house just below the roof.
An attic may also be called a sky parlor or a garret.
Because attics fill the space between the ceiling of the top floor of a building and the slanted roof they are known for being awkwardly shaped spaces with exposed rafters and difficult to reach corners.
